Walter A.
"Sonny" Fieleke
July 21, 1937 – August 3, 2020
Walter A. "Sonny" Fieleke Jr, 83, of rural Lafayette, died at his home on Monday-August 3, 2020 at 4:35pm after a 3 year battle with cancer. He was born July 21, 1937 in Kankakee, IL, to the late Walter & Cleta Doehring Fieleke. His marriage was to Alice N. Welker in Momence, IL, on July 27, 1957, and she preceded him in death on April 12, 1997. He was a 1955 graduate of Momence High School in IL. He, his brother Calvin, and his brother in law Ray, all owned and operated a Brake Shop in Tampa, FL for many years, then moved back to Delphi, where he farmed in Carroll & Tippecanoe Counties, raising grain and cattle, until his retirement from farming in 2000. He was a member and deacon of the First Baptist Church in Delphi, and also served as an usher. He enjoyed mechanics, and liked to build hot-rod cars and trucks. He and his family always took a yearly vacation, a road trip to somewhere, making lots of memories on the way. He liked watching Purdue men's basketball.
